I used to have a cat, and a wife too, but this story is mostly about the cat.

She had those follow-the-people dog-like urges, but she had regular cat pride and aloofness.

When my wife and I would go upstairs retiring for the evening, the cat would follow. But, only after a prideful delay of five to ten minutes, trying to give the appearance that her retiring for the evening when we did was nothing but coincidence.

And when she got upstairs, she wouldn't come fully into the bedroom. She would sit in the door way ~~~~with her back facing into the room~~~~ just for an extra little display of indifference.

Actually, I don't think this is altogether rare. People talk about them all having different personalities. Well, they may each have their own set of "plays." But they all come out of the official cat "playbook," which really is a fairly small document. (It's first page used to explain to cats how to respond to paper grocery bags on the floor which came awfully close to being a universal cat behavior. Don't know what they do now with the prevalence of plastic grocery bags.)
